What a fabulous thriller! FAB-U-LOUS! The story starts with Charlie finding himself slumped against his husband Mathew’s dead body. Rachel, their dinner guest calls 999 with a bloody knife gripped in her hand. Charlie and Mathew’s son Titus has retired to his bedroom. The police come in, Rachel confesses to the crime and is arrested. End of story, you think? Nope! This is just the beginning…

We are then taken to the past – the events leading up to the murder. How Charlie and Mathew met, married; Titus and his ‘adventures’ (ahem!); how Rachel ended up at the book club and into the lives of Charlie and Mathew. While the rest of the family and friends adored Rachel, Charlie disliked her. He thought there was something odd about her.

The Dinner Guest is not your usual domestic thriller. The suspense is sure to keep you on the edge of the seat. Also, if you think you are smart enough to identity the killer – think again, my friend. The red herrings are plenty and sure to take one on the wrong path. Almost every chapter ends with a twist – some of which you never see it coming.
